From the recent mean girls reboot to upcoming sequels for films like megamind and moana, contemporary popular entertainment seems to be rooted in the continuous (re)manufacture of memory. indeed, the practice of leveraging our fond memories of the past for profit has a name: nostalgia baiting. While nostalgia baiting has always existed, and it is no secret to advertisers that consumers like things that are already familiar to them or that were essential to them in pivotal times of their lives, like childhood, it now seems to be more rampant than ever.
